The Nicholson Project is a nonprofit organization dedicated to fostering creativity through an artist residency program and a neighborhood garden, serving as a cultural hub that supports artists. With an operating budget of $294.5K and total revenue of $344.8K for the 2024 filing year, the organization is financially supported by multiple funders, none of which contribute 50% or more of its revenue. Frequently Asked Questions
What is THE NICHOLSON PROJECT’s budget?
In 2024, THE NICHOLSON PROJECT reported an annual operating budget of around $295 thousand. More detailed financial information is available to registered users.
Where does THE NICHOLSON PROJECT operate?
THE NICHOLSON PROJECT is headquartered in Washington, DC.
Who funded THE NICHOLSON PROJECT recently?
In 2025, THE NICHOLSON PROJECT received grants from Cultural Development Corporation of the District of Columbia, GREATER WASHINGTON COMMUNITY FOUNDATION, and AMERICAN ONLINE GIVING FOUNDATION INC. More information on this organization’s funders is available to registered users.
What is the largest grant THE NICHOLSON PROJECT received in 2024?
The largest grant to THE NICHOLSON PROJECT in 2024 exceeds $22 thousand.
What is THE NICHOLSON PROJECT’s reliance on government grants?
THE NICHOLSON PROJECT relied on government grants for more than 55% of their total revenue in 2024.
